The Remington Model 510-P The Targetmaster was a single shot, bolt action, .22 rimfire rifle made from 1939 (when it costs only $6.70) until December 1960 in Ilion, New York. It was same rifle as model 510-A but with Patridge-type front sight mounted on the ramp and adjustable rear peep sight with interchangeable discs. The 510 is designed to have the safety become active after every shot.
